2019: Announcement

At the end of October, 2019 Mastercard announced that it in cooperation with Envisible company creates a blockchain platform for tracking of a supply chain of seafood.

The new Wholechain system from software developer for tracking of Envisible food will work based on the Provenance platform. It will allow suppliers to check compliance of seafood to ethical and environmental standards. Besides, the enterprises using the Wholechain system will be connected to MasterCard payment system, i.e. will be able not only to monitor deliveries, but also to pay them.

The American retail network selling food products of Topco became the first user of a new system. For a start the origin of such goods as a salmon, a cod and shrimps will be traced. In shops of Topco network buyers will see special QR codes on seafood. Having scanned them using the smartphone, they will be able to obtain summary of where fish was hooked and as it was brought to shop.

Initially the Provenance platform was created by MasterCard for tracking of designer clothes and luxury goods, but now the company intends to expand its application. No wonder - Gartner survey conducted in 2019 among the 850th a blockchain projects worldwide showed that tracking of a supply chain quickly gains popularity, and similar projects turn into the status pilot more often, than other options of use of blockchain technologies.

Tracking of a supply chain of MasterCard and Envisible is an example hybrid a blockchain system where data are transmitted through the blockchain closed from strangers, and information for the consumer is in a public part of a system which can be loaded in the form of mobile application. It is expected that hybrid blockchains will dominate on the arena of e-commerce.[1]
